John TEMM Obituary

Sadly passed away peacefully at home on 2nd May 2025; aged 74 years. Dearly loved husband of Val. Cherished Dad and Father-In-Law of Susan and Clint, Lisa and Aaron. Treasured Pop to Jamie, Hayden, Matthew and Zoe. A service to celebrate John's life will be held at the Park Chapel, Newstead Crematorium, 395 Morrinsville Road, Hamilton, on Thursday 8th May 2025, at 1.00pm. In lieu of flowers, donations to Hospice Waikato would be appreciated. All communications to The Temm Family, c/- Woolerton's Funeral Home, PO box 276, Hamilton 3204.


Published by Waikato Times on May 5, 2025.
